Judgment text excerpt
The Supreme Court upheld the dismissal of the appellant's Second Appeal under Section 100 of the Code of Civil Procedure, 1908, affirming that the earlier suit for title and injunction did not bar the subsequent suit for recovery of possession as per Order II Rule 2. The Court found that the appellant's claim of being a co-owner and tenant under the Kerala Compensation for Tenants Improvements Act, 1958 was not substantiated, as he failed to prove tenancy or improvements made to the property. The Court concluded that the plaintiffs were the rightful legal heirs entitled to possession of the property.
